As proved by the transatlantic flights of Lindbergh and Earhart, postwar airplanes were engineered to fly greater distance.

A transatlantic flight is the one of an aircraft accross the Atlantic Ocean from Africa, The Middle Easte or Europe to North America, Central America and South America or vice versa.

Charles Lindbergh crossed the Atlantic Ocean and landed safety less than 34 years later in Paris. Thus, he became the first pilot to solo a nonstop transatlantic flight, and as a result he changed public opinion with regard the value of air travel and laid the foundation for the future development of aviation.

Amelia Mary Earhart was the first female aviator to fly solo across the Atlantic Ocean. She became a pioneer.

What is the term used to describe the politics of an area of a city run by a “boss?” precinct lobbyist machine legislature
AleksAgata [21]
Hi there!

Political machines, or in your case, machines, are referred to as political organizations in which a boss runs the politics of an area. Precinct is a term used to organize areas of a city, lobbyist are people advocating with the intention to induce change, and legislature is the group of people who pass laws and ordinances in a city. Therefore, the only logical answer would be...

C. Machine
